THE KARNATAKA MUNICIPAL CORPORATIONS (AMENDMENT) ACT, 2014
(Received the assent of the Governor on the Twenty–eighth day of February, 2014)
KARNATAKA ACT NO. 21 OF 2014
(First Published in the Karnataka Gazette Extra-ordinary on the Twenty–eighth day of February, 2014)
An Act further to amend the Karnataka Municipal Corporations Act, 1976.
Whereas it is expedient further to amend the Karnataka Municipal Corporations Act, 1976 (Karnataka Act 14 of 1977) for the purposes hereinafter appearing;
Be it enacted by the Karnataka State Legislature in the Sixty Fifth year of the Republic of India as follows, namely:-
1. Short title and commencement.– (1) This Act may be called the Karnataka Municipal Corporations (Amendment) Act, 2014.
(2) It shall come into force at once.
2. Amendment of section 503.- In section 503 of the Karnataka Municipal Corporations Act, 1976 (Karnataka Act 14 of 1977) after sub-section (4), the following proviso, shall be inserted, namely:-
"Provided that where the larger urban area so constituted does not have any newly added area and the election to such smaller urban area was held within one year before the date of declaration of Larger urban area, the election to such larger urban area for constitution of a corporation need not to be held till the completion of the term of members of smaller urban area so elected (irrespective of whether City Municipal Council was constituted or not) and the members of smaller urban area shall continue to be members of the larger urban area corporation to be constituted till the completion of their term so elected and a corporation shall be constituted by treating the said elected members as councilors of the corporation under Section 7 ".
